Soft and hard bounces erode sender reputation
Every invalid email address that doesn't exist generates a hard bounce. If you're sending at high volume, even a few hundred of these over a short period signal poor list hygiene. Bounce rates above 2% are commonly flagged as red flags by ISPs like Gmail and Microsoft, which use bounce data as part of their filtering algorithms.
Soft bounces—temporary failures due to full inboxes or server timeouts—also accumulate. While not as severe as hard bounces, high soft bounce rates degrade sender reputation over time. Let’s be clear: if 3% of your list is invalid, you’re already near or above thresholds that trigger automated filters at BOL and UOL level.
Spamhaus and other reputable sources emphasize sender reputation as a core factor in email filtering decisions. A poor reputation means higher chance of emails landing in spam or being blocked entirely.
Risky addresses bypass or get flagged
Not all bad addresses are nonexistent—they can be risky. Role accounts like admin@, sales@, or support@ are often ignored or quarantined, especially in bulk sends. Email providers treat these as low-value or automated, often routing them to spam or discarding them silently.
Disposable email domains (like mailinator.com or temp-mail.org) are a standard red flag. Email services assume these are temporary, high-fraud or high-bounce accounts. Sending to them doesn't just waste bandwidth—it can signal that your list contains low-quality or purchased addresses.
Catch-all inboxes—configured to accept any email—may technically accept your message, but they’re frequently associated with bots or abuse. ISPs track engagement. If no one opens or interacts with content sent to a catch-all, that’s negative engagement. It tells the provider your list is unreliable.
Even if these addresses “deliver,” high volumes of such sends can trigger BOL/ UOL filters. For example, if 10% of your list consists of role accounts or disposable domains, your message may never reach the inbox—reaching only filters, quarantines, or auto-deletion systems.

Remove disposable and fake domains
- Block domains like mailinator.com, throwawaymail.com, and temp-mail.org. These are commonly used for spam traps or fraud, and emails sent there fail delivery or get flagged.
- Use a real-time email verification service like MailTester’s API to catch these instantly during list entry.
Filter role accounts and unengaged users
- Mark and exclude role-based addresses like info@, support@, admin@ unless you're targeting them directly. These often sit behind high-volatility spam filters and harm engagement metrics.
- Remove any email that hasn’t opened, clicked, or interacted in six months or more. These dormant accounts hurt your deliverability score—major ESPs like Gmail and Outlook use inactivity as a signal to suppress mail.
- Verify if a domain accepts any email (catch-all). A catch-all setup means every address—even invalid ones—gets delivered. This leads to false positives during verification and inflated “valid” counts, which mislead your deliverability tracking.
- Use tools that detect catch-all domains during list cleaning. MailTester's bulk verification identifies these with a specific “catch-all” flag so you can filter them out.
